Westinghouse Orders Show Large Increase. For the 2nd quarter of 1934, Westinghouse Electric & Mfg. Co. orders totaled $33,655,022, as compared with $20,237,588 for the previous quarter and $17,557,964 for the second quarter of 1933. Sales billed for the second quarter of 1934 totaled $27,287,545, compared to $17,994,045 for the previous quarter, and $15,926,335 for the corresponding quarter of 1933. Unfilled orders at June 30 were $31,892,155 as compared with $24,705,173 on June 30, 1933. According to President F. A. Merrick, orders received for the first half of 1934 show increase of 77% over a similar period m 1933.
